The notice of proposed changes is a formal document that outlines any upcoming modifications or alterations to a particular situation or entity.
Any individual or entity that is planning to make significant changes that could potentially impact others is required to file a notice of proposed changes.
The notice of proposed changes can usually be filled out by providing detailed information about the changes being proposed, the reasons for the changes, and any potential impacts.
The purpose of the notice of proposed changes is to inform relevant parties about upcoming modifications and give them an opportunity to provide feedback or raise any concerns.
The notice of proposed changes typically includes information about the nature of the changes, the expected timeline, potential impacts, and any steps being taken to mitigate negative consequences.
